Marionberry every time I boot up.

Every time I boot up destiny for the first time in a given session (IE, one booting of my Xbox One), I'm booted out with the Marionberry error. Quitting and re-entering the game lets me enter and play just fine. Error is repeatable and consistent. Bug has been occurring for a while, even pre-DLC.

    Hey dude! The documentation for MARIONBERRY can be found [url=http://www.bungie.net/en/Help/Article/11877]here[/url]. It's defined as a local network failure. Power down your console and power cycle your router/modem. This should solve an discrepancies. If the problem persists, it's likely you firmeware or (god forbid) your hardware had deteriorated within one of the devices itself.
